Abstract

fetched live from OpenAlex

In this paper the authors present a short description of the first two levels of the Chemical Engineering curriculum integration at the Université de Sherbrooke, followed by a more comprehensive presentation of the Final year Design project course, a 10 credits activity. This activity is already 12 years old. Its main ambition and objectives were and are to integrate all knowledge acquired by the students through the “8 academic + 5 industry work training” sessions. Such integration brings the Chemical Engineering graduates closer to the market reality and needs by opening their minds “outside the box” and improving their creative skills and innovation desires. The echo received so far is very positive and the effort, qualified as successful by our industrial partners, provides us all with the necessary motivation to continue in this direction and improve, by remaining as creative as possible. The intermediate integration level in years 2 and 3 is the fruit of this motivation.
